Transaction 3b77423c9096002e3d0bfc1487b383b4275cdb9770122f449983cf329deaf477
1 Input
1 Output
-
3b77423c9096002e3d0bfc1487b383b4275cdb9770122f449983cf329deaf477:0
- value
- 43370
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c5111bbd73f7065ad71e3e491ef2e1ffe77d71ff OP_EQUAL
- address
- 3Kf1Y3WJMviaEpbWmnteKUqnxQGYdFrx9E